Summary
Overview
Work History
Education
Skills
Projects
References
Languages
Timeline
Generic

Effie Dong

Coomera,QLD

Summary

Highly skilled Software Engineer & AI Developer with 3+ years of experience in mobile, web, and AI-driven applications. Proficient in iOS (Swift/SwiftUI), Android (Kotlin/Compose), Flutter, and React, with strong expertise in scalable architecture, UI/UX, and system design. Adept at integrating AI/ML solutions for smarter, data-driven user experiences. Experienced in GitHub, Firebase, and collaborative development, delivering clean, robust, and maintainable software.

Overview

4
4
years of professional experience

Work History

Software Engineer

M&J Production
Surfers Paradise, QLD
01.2025 - Current
  • Integrated third-party APIs to expand application features and capabilities.
  • Developed web-based applications using React, Node.js, JavaScript, HTML, and CSS.
  • Designed user interfaces for AI applications to improve overall user experience.
  • Built AI applications utilizing Langchain, Postgres, and Docker.

IOS DEVELOPER

M&J Production
01.2024 - 01.2025
  • Developed JokerPlus app for Malaysian company using Swift, SwiftUI, and UIKit for betting features.
  • Participated in JokerPlus Android app project utilizing Kotlin for cross-platform functionality.
  • Conducted API testing with Postman to ensure reliability and performance.

APP DEVELOPER

Universal Site Monitoring
08.2021 - 11.2023
  • Developed Global Asset Monitoring app, integrating Bluetooth for real-time data retrieval.
  • Implemented USM Alarm App, enabling real-time alert notifications and asset tracking on Android and iOS.
  • Utilized Flutter and Dart frameworks to advance mobile app development.
  • Engineered 3D Web App for indoor location tracking using Three.js and Angular.
  • Deployed GAM Android app with MVVM architecture and Compose for modern UI.
  • Constructed GAM iOS app leveraging SwiftUI, Core Data, and background task management.
  • Integrated Firebase services for effective push notifications and application monitoring.

Education

Master of Information Technology -

University of Melbourne
Melbourne, VIC
01.2020

Skills

  • Swift, SwiftUI, UIKit, and Combine
  • Kotlin, Jetpack
  • Python, Django, Postgres
  • Langchain, Langgraph, Langsmith
  • React, JavaScript, HTML, and CSS
  • Git version control
  • SQL and NoSQL databases
  • Api development and integration
  • Flutter framework
  • MVVM architecture

Projects

Joker Chatbot | LangChain, Postgres, Django, Docker

  • Designed and developed an AI-powered customer service chatbot, enabling automated responses and improved support efficiency
  • Deployed on staging environment: https://www.staging.chatadmin.mjproapps.com/newManager

JokerPlus Web | React

  • Built a responsive web application for a Malaysian gaming company, supporting real-time betting and gaming features.
  • Live site: https://jokerplus.com/main

JokerPlus Mobile | Swift, UIKit

  • Developed a native iOS mobile app for betting and gaming, delivering a smooth and reliable user experience

Global Asset Monitoring (GAM) | Android (Kotlin, Jetpack, Compose), iOS (Swift, SwiftUI)

  • Engineered mobile apps integrate Bluetooth connectivity to interface with company hardware devices and phone sensors
  • Implemented offline caching, real-time data sync, and seamless backend integration for worker safety monitoring

USM Alarm App | Flutter, Dart, Firebase

  • Created a cross-platform mobile app that provides real-time alarm state monitoring of assets
  • Integrated Firebase push notifications and Google Maps SDK for live alerts and location-based responses

Crypto Token Bank | React, Node.js, Blockchain

  • Built a web application for cryptocurrency transactions and an NFT marketplace using a self-developed token
  • GitHub: https://github.com/FeiElf/token.git

Movie App | Swift, UIKit, MVVM

  • Developed an iOS application showcasing trending movies, with rating features and TMDB API integration
  • GitHub: https://github.com/FeiElf/Movie-App.git

References

  • Lihong Tang, Research Software Engineer, lihongtang.work@gmail.com, 0416-768-119
  • Jessica Chen, Senior Full Stack Developer, calmdowngirl.au@gmail.com, 045-721-0926
  • Peter Green, Project Manager, pgreen@usm.net.au, 088-986-7177

Languages

English
Professional
Mandarin
Native/ Bilingual

Timeline

Software Engineer

M&J Production
01.2025 - Current

IOS DEVELOPER

M&J Production
01.2024 - 01.2025

APP DEVELOPER

Universal Site Monitoring
08.2021 - 11.2023

Master of Information Technology -

University of Melbourne
Effie Dong